I use ventrilo for some of my gaming. A program to communicate through a mic. Ventrilo said windows xp could give a static problem when I transmit a message. But instead of static I get a thumping noise. Now could it be windows xp or my fans? Tested: Doesnt matter what mic I use and I tried using the the accessories ound recorder....and I came up with the same results. So my questions are...

1) Would it be better to use a usb mic..(possibly reduce or stop the thumping noise)?
2) Maybe a hot fix for windows xp?
3)Should I use a certain microphone for this situation that cancels that type of noise?

The vibrations of the fans would vibrate the mic input. Creating noises and what not. I have fixed my problem by using a usb mic with noise cancelation. Got rid of the fan noise and a small problem with my mouse interfering some how ...it made a small noise everytime I move it.
